Rent trends in North Redondo Beach, Redondo Beach, CA

Average rent prices in North Redondo Beach have increased by 6% over the last month and have decreased by 14% since last year.

Compare rent prices in North Redondo Beach, Redondo Beach, CA

Rent prices in North Redondo Beach vary by bedroom size, rental type, and neighborhood. The average rent for an apartment in North Redondo Beach is $2,750, whereas a house costs $5,500. 1-bedroom apartments in North Redondo Beach run $2,200 on average, while 2-bedroom apartments are $2,750.

Frequently asked questions for North Redondo Beach, Redondo Beach, CA

Quick answers to common questions about the North Redondo Beach rental market.

How much is rent in North Redondo Beach?

The average rent in North Redondo Beach is $3,200 per month as of May 23, 2026.

Is rent up or down in North Redondo Beach?

Average rent prices in North Redondo Beach have increased by 6% over the last month and have decreased by 14% since last year.

How does North Redondo Beach rent compare to the national average?

Rent in North Redondo Beach is 64% above the national average, which means renters are paying approximately $1,250 more per month.

What salary do I need to afford rent in North Redondo Beach?

To comfortably afford rent in North Redondo Beach, you'd need to earn approximately $128,000/year, based on spending no more than 30% of your income on rent.

Methodology

Rent prices are based on Zumper's rental listings from the past 30 days. Median rent is calculated across all available listings and property types on the platform. If you filter the page by bedroom count or property type, the pricing throughout the page will update automatically to reflect that segment of the rental market.

Household and population data come from the U.S. Census Bureau. Cost-of-living data is sourced from the Council for Community and Economic Research's Cost of Living Index (COLI).
